🧪 How Tubeless Tyre Sealant Works

Tubeless sealants are usually latex-based liquids suspended with fibres or particles. When a puncture occurs, air rushes out and draws the sealant toward the hole. As it contacts air, the latex rapidly coagulates, forming a plug that seals the puncture—usually in seconds.

Sealants differ in:

  • Puncture size they can seal

  • Drying time inside the tyre

  • Temperature range

  • Ease of clean-up

  • Weight and rolling resistance impact


🏆 Best Tubeless Tyre Sealants – Reviewed

1. Stan’s NoTubes Sealant

Best All-Rounder for Most Riders
💷 ~£20 (473ml)

Stan’s is the industry benchmark, sealing holes up to 6mm quickly. It works across road, gravel and MTB setups and lasts 2–7 months depending on climate.

✅ Seals large punctures quickly
✅ Lightweight formula
✅ Compatible with CO₂
❌ Needs refreshing every few months


2. Muc-Off No Puncture Hassle Tubeless Sealant

Best for Aggressive MTB & Enduro Riders
💷 ~£10 (140ml pouch)

With a UV tracer for detecting leaks and Kevlar fibres for larger holes, this sealant suits hard-hitting off-road riders. It’s available in small pouches and larger workshop bottles.

✅ Strong puncture sealing (up to 6mm+)
✅ UV tracer to detect leaks
✅ Smells better than most
❌ Not the best for cold climates


3. Orange Seal Endurance Formula

Longest Lasting Sealant
💷 ~£15 (240ml)

Great for riders who don’t want to top up sealant often. It seals well and lasts up to 120 days—ideal for gravel, touring and summer roadies.

✅ Long life
✅ Works well with wider tyres
✅ Seals multiple punctures
❌ Slightly messy install


4. Effetto Mariposa Caffélatex

Best for Road & High-Pressure Tyres
💷 ~£12 (250ml)

This foaming latex sealant spreads evenly under pressure—making it a favourite for fast road riders. It’s also ammonia-free, so safe for sensitive rims.

✅ Ideal for 80–120psi pressures
✅ No smell or ammonia
✅ Foams for even distribution
❌ Not the best at sealing large holes


5. Peaty’s Tubeless Sealant

Eco-Friendly & Made in the UK
💷 ~£15 (500ml)

Founded by World Cup MTB legend Steve Peat, this plant-based sealant is tough and planet-conscious. It features biodegradable glitter to aid sealing.

✅ Eco-friendly ingredients
✅ Seals well with zero harsh chemicals
✅ Great branding and UK-based
❌ Slightly shorter lifespan than others


📊 Comparison Table – 2025 Sealant Showdown

Sealant Best For Seals Size Lifespan Eco-Friendly Price (approx)
Stan’s NoTubes All-round use Up to 6mm 2–7 months £20 (473ml)
Muc-Off No Puncture Hassle MTB & Enduro Up to 6mm+ 2–6 months £10 (140ml)
Orange Seal Endurance Long-distance/gravel Up to 6mm Up to 120 days £15 (240ml)
Effetto Mariposa Caffélatex Road & high pressure Up to 4mm 2–4 months £12 (250ml)
Peaty’s Tubeless Sealant Eco MTB & commuters Up to 5mm 2–5 months £15 (500ml)

🔧 Pro Tips

  • Shake it up! Always shake the bottle before use to suspend particles evenly.

  • Check regularly—sealants dry out faster in hot weather or dry climates.

  • Add through the valve (with core removed) for cleaner installs.

  • Don’t mix brands unless the manufacturer says it’s compatible.
